How to fill out a crop project record:

01
Start by gathering all the necessary information such as the type of crop, planting date, harvest date, and any relevant notes or observations about the crop.
02
Fill in the required fields on the crop project record form, providing accurate and detailed information. This may include the crop variety, seed source, planting method, and any amendments or treatments used.
03
Record the crop's progress throughout the growing season, noting any significant milestones or changes. This can include monitoring growth, pest and disease management, irrigation schedules, and fertilization practices.
04
Update the crop project record regularly, ideally after each significant event or task related to the crop. This will ensure that the record remains accurate and comprehensive.
05
Keep track of any yields or harvest data, including quantity, quality, and market value of the crop. This will help in analyzing the success and profitability of the project.
06
Don't forget to document any challenges or lessons learned during the crop project. This information can be valuable for future projects and decision-making.

Who needs a crop project record:

01
Farmers – Crop project records help farmers keep track of their agricultural activities and make informed decisions based on historical data. It allows them to evaluate the success of different crop varieties or techniques and identify areas for improvement.
02
Agricultural researchers – Crop project records are essential for agricultural researchers to conduct experiments, analyze results, and draw conclusions. These records provide valuable insights into crop performance, planting techniques, and potential solutions for various challenges.
03
Landowners or farm managers – Keeping detailed crop project records helps landowners or farm managers assess the productivity and profitability of their land. This information aids in making informed decisions regarding crop selection, resource allocation, and overall farm management strategies.
